Yesterday, 06:14 PM
Hey Folks! I wanted to share my personal tool for renaming acquired files for media server use. With it you can rename any number of tv shows, movies, seasons, or episodes with a single command. An interactive preview is shown before any changes are made. Intelligent parsing of file names and directory context allows this tool to handle any naming convention found on the web. If you find media names that can't be parsed automatically by Title Tidy, feel free to open and issue and I'll get it fixed!
Four command are included:
Shows - Rename show directories, seasons, and episode and subtitles all in one command.
Movies - Renames movies. Is also capable of creating directories to hold the movie (For downloads that are standalone files).
Seasons - Rename a season folder and its containing episode and subtitle files. Perfect for when you've acquired a new season.
Episodes - Rename standalone episode movie and subtitle files.
For those processing media in a pipeline, Title Tidy includes a --instant(-i) flag to skip the interactive UI.
Check out these demos!
Renaming several shows with multiple seasons and episodes:
![[Image: vhs-4azhoxRPBT1c1bZ5lcxIWp.gif]](https://vhs.charm.sh/vhs-4azhoxRPBT1c1bZ5lcxIWp.gif)
Renaming several movies and subs (and creating directories to hold them):
![[Image: vhs-5USdlv7mAxvQ2tybsXE7Ja.gif]](https://vhs.charm.sh/vhs-5USdlv7mAxvQ2tybsXE7Ja.gif)
All demos are in the readme
Four command are included:
Shows - Rename show directories, seasons, and episode and subtitles all in one command.
Movies - Renames movies. Is also capable of creating directories to hold the movie (For downloads that are standalone files).
Seasons - Rename a season folder and its containing episode and subtitle files. Perfect for when you've acquired a new season.
Episodes - Rename standalone episode movie and subtitle files.
For those processing media in a pipeline, Title Tidy includes a --instant(-i) flag to skip the interactive UI.
Check out these demos!
Renaming several shows with multiple seasons and episodes:
![[Image: vhs-4azhoxRPBT1c1bZ5lcxIWp.gif]](https://vhs.charm.sh/vhs-4azhoxRPBT1c1bZ5lcxIWp.gif)
Renaming several movies and subs (and creating directories to hold them):
![[Image: vhs-5USdlv7mAxvQ2tybsXE7Ja.gif]](https://vhs.charm.sh/vhs-5USdlv7mAxvQ2tybsXE7Ja.gif)
All demos are in the readme
